BenQ PD2770U 27" Preto
Why we recommend this ▼
Factory calibrated to Calman Verified and Pantone Validated standards, its 27-inch 4K IPS panel covers 99% Adobe RGB, 99% DCI-P3, and 100% Rec.709 with uniform color and dark tone reproduction. A 96W USB-C port with Thunderbolt enables single-cable docking and the stand offers tilt, swivel, pivot, and height adjustment. This monitor is best for graphic designers and video editors needing out-of-the-box color accuracy and corner-to-corner uniformity for print and digital deliverables.
BenQ PhotoVue SW272U 27" Black
Why we recommend this ▼
Factory-calibrated coverage of 99% Adobe RGB and DCI-P3 on this 27-inch 4K IPS panel ensures color-critical work is accurate straight out of the box. The included shading hood and Hotkey Puck G3 streamline a workflow already bolstered by 90W USB-C power delivery and a built-in SD card reader. This monitor is best for photographers and video editors who require hardware-calibrated color precision in a studio setting.
BenQ MOBIUZ EX321UZ 31.5" White 2026
Why we recommend this ▼
Its 31.5-inch 4K QD-OLED panel delivers a 240Hz refresh and 0.03ms response with 1000-nit HDR peaks, producing fluid, high-contrast visuals. DisplayPort 2.1, dual HDMI 2.1, and a 90W USB-C port with an integrated KVM switch offer extensive connectivity for mixed-use environments. It suits gamers who also handle color-critical creative work and need a single display to manage multiple devices.
